Job Opportunity: Content Operations Analyst

This position is listed on behalf of a partner company, who manages all applications and next steps. Our partner is looking for a Content Operations Analyst based in the United Kingdom.

Join a fast-growing SaaS environment where you'll play a key role in ensuring high-quality digital content experiences for globally recognized brands, particularly within the sports industry. This position combines content operations, quality assurance, and operational support in a dynamic, shift-based environment. You'll leverage AI-powered tools and internal platforms to manage content workflows, validate outputs, and resolve operational issues with speed and accuracy. Working independently while collaborating with cross-functional teams, you'll help maintain reliable content delivery and exceptional client experiences. This is an excellent opportunity for detail-oriented professionals who enjoy structured workflows, continuous improvement, and emerging AI technologies.

Accountabilities:

As a Content Operations Analyst, you will manage day-to-day content operations, ensuring content is accurately prepared, reviewed, delivered, and maintained while supporting live operational workflows. You will be responsible for maintaining quality standards, providing first-line operational support, and improving workflow efficiency through AI-assisted tools and best practices.

  • Manage assigned content operations tasks from intake through completion while ensuring quality, accuracy, and timely delivery.
  • Prepare content packages, reports, and client deliverables using internal tools and documented workflows.
  • Perform quality assurance checks on generated content, applications, and digital experiences.
  • Maintain content records, operational documentation, and recurring workflow tasks.
  • Deliver client-ready reports, links, and status updates with accuracy and professionalism.
  • Provide first-line support during scheduled shifts by investigating content and operational issues, gathering evidence, and escalating when appropriate.
  • Monitor live content during sports events and perform operational checks to ensure reliable delivery.
  • Utilize AI-powered tools to streamline content validation, documentation, comparison, and repetitive operational processes while verifying output quality.
  • Produce clear handover documentation to ensure seamless collaboration across shifts.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ement by identifying recurring issues and recommending workflow enhancements.

Requirements:

The ideal candidate is highly organ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able working independently in a fast-paced, shift-based environment. You should possess strong analytical skills, excellent judgment, and the ability to balance speed with accuracy while embracing AI-assisted workflows.

  • Ability to independently manage operational workflows and prioritize multiple tasks.
  • Strong attention to detail with excellent quality assurance and verification skills.
  • Experience using AI tools to improve productivity while validating generated outputs.
  • Excellent written communication skills with the ability to document work clearly and concisely.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and sound decision-making within defined operational processes.
  • Ability to recognize issues, gather supporting evidence, and escalate effectively when required.
  • Comfortable working rotating shifts, including evenings, weekends, and live event coverage.
  • Interest in sports, media, SaaS, publishing, or digital content operations.
